news 2026/4/3 4:29:16

MTranServer 终极安装配置指南:快速搭建私有部署翻译服务

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
MTranServer 终极安装配置指南:快速搭建私有部署翻译服务

MTranServer 终极安装配置指南:快速搭建私有部署翻译服务

【免费下载链接】MTranServerLow-resource, fast, and privately self-host free version of Google Translate - 低占用速度快可私有部署的自由版 Google 翻译项目地址: https://gitcode.com/gh_mirrors/mt/MTranServer

想要拥有一个完全掌控在自己手中的离线翻译服务吗?MTranServer为您提供了完美的解决方案。这个开源项目实现了低资源消耗、超快速响应的私有部署翻译服务,让您无需依赖任何第三方API即可享受高质量的翻译体验。

🚀 项目核心优势

MTranServer是一个专门为追求效率和隐私的用户设计的离线翻译服务器。它具备以下突出特点:

  • 极速响应:单个请求平均响应时间仅50毫秒
  • 低资源占用:无需显卡支持,普通CPU即可运行
  • 完全离线:所有翻译过程都在本地完成,保护您的数据隐私
  • 多语言支持:覆盖全球主要语言的互译功能
  • 跨平台部署:支持Docker容器化部署,简化运维流程

📋 安装前准备工作

在开始安装之前,请确保您的系统环境满足以下基本要求:

系统环境检查

  • 支持的操作系统:Linux、Windows、macOS
  • 内存要求:最低2GB可用内存
  • 网络连接:首次使用需要联网下载模型文件

必要软件安装

确保系统中已安装以下软件:

  • Docker(推荐使用Docker Compose部署)
  • Git(用于获取项目源码)

🛠️ 详细安装步骤

步骤一:获取项目源码

打开终端,执行以下命令下载MTranServer项目:

git clone https://gitcode.com/gh_mirrors/mt/MTranServer cd MTranServer

步骤二:Docker快速部署

这是最简单的部署方式,特别适合新手用户。在项目根目录下创建compose.yml文件:

services: mtranserver: image: xxnuo/mtranserver:latest container_name: mtranserver restart: unless-stopped ports: - "8989:8989" environment: - MT_HOST=0.0.0.0 - MT_PORT=8989 - MT_ENABLE_UI=true - MT_OFFLINE=false volumes: - ./models:/app/models

步骤三:启动翻译服务

执行以下命令启动服务:

docker compose up -d

服务启动后,您可以通过浏览器访问以下地址:

  • Web用户界面:http://localhost:8989
  • API文档:http://localhost:8989/docs

⚙️ 基础配置说明

环境变量配置

通过修改compose.yml文件中的环境变量,您可以自定义服务行为:

  • MT_HOST:服务器监听地址(默认0.0.0.0)
  • MT_PORT:服务端口号(默认8989)
  • MT_ENABLE_UI:是否启用Web界面(默认true)
  • MT_OFFLINE:是否启用离线模式(默认false)

安全配置建议

为了保护您的翻译服务,建议设置API访问令牌:

environment: - MT_API_TOKEN=your_secret_token_here

🔌 浏览器插件集成

MTranServer支持与多种流行的翻译浏览器插件无缝集成:

沉浸式翻译插件配置

在插件设置中启用自定义API,填写以下地址:

http://localhost:8989/imme

简约翻译插件配置

在接口设置中选择自定义模式,使用以下配置:

http://localhost:8989/kiss

📊 服务验证与测试

界面访问验证

打开浏览器,访问http://localhost:8989,您应该能看到翻译操作界面。如果界面正常显示,说明服务部署成功。

API功能测试

使用curl命令测试翻译功能:

curl -X POST "http://localhost:8989/translate" \ -H "Content-Type: application/json" \ -d '{"from": "en", "to": "zh", "text": "Hello, world!"}'

🎯 使用技巧与最佳实践

模型管理优化

首次使用特定语言对时,系统会自动下载对应的翻译模型。建议在正式使用前先进行测试翻译,让服务器预先加载所需模型。

性能调优建议

根据您的服务器配置,适当调整以下参数:

  • 并发请求数量
  • 模型缓存设置
  • 内存分配策略

❓ 常见问题解答

Q: 服务启动后无法访问界面怎么办?A: 检查防火墙设置,确保8989端口已开放。

Q: 翻译响应时间变慢如何解决?A: 检查系统资源使用情况,可能需要重启服务或清理缓存。

Q: 如何更新到最新版本?A: 执行docker compose pull && docker compose up -d

💡 进阶功能探索

MTranServer还提供了丰富的进阶功能,包括:

  • 批量翻译接口
  • 多种翻译引擎兼容
  • 自定义模型加载

通过本指南,您已经成功搭建了一个功能完整的私有部署翻译服务。MTranServer以其出色的性能和易用性,将成为您日常翻译工作的得力助手。如果在使用过程中遇到任何问题,欢迎查阅项目文档或在社区中寻求帮助。

【免费下载链接】MTranServerLow-resource, fast, and privately self-host free version of Google Translate - 低占用速度快可私有部署的自由版 Google 翻译项目地址: https://gitcode.com/gh_mirrors/mt/MTranServer

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/3 3:40:56

YimMenuV2:GTA V模组开发框架的完整解决方案

YimMenuV2:GTA V模组开发框架的完整解决方案 【免费下载链接】YimMenuV2 Unfinished WIP 项目地址: https://gitcode.com/GitHub_Trending/yi/YimMenuV2 YimMenuV2为GTA V模组开发者提供了一套基于C20标准的现代化框架,致力于简化游戏逆向工程和模…

作者头像 李华
网站建设 2026/3/26 16:04:38

OrcaSlicer终极指南:如何用开源切片软件实现专业级3D打印效果

OrcaSlicer作为一款专为FDM 3D打印机设计的开源切片软件,融合了Bambu Studio和SuperSlicer的精华特性,为新手和资深用户提供了前所未有的打印精度和控制能力。这款软件支持自动校准、Sandwich模式、精确壁功能等先进技术,让您的3D打印体验更加…

作者头像 李华
网站建设 2026/3/29 16:48:29

新手教程:2025机顶盒刷机包与定制ROM入门必看

老盒子也能玩出新花样:2025年机顶盒刷机实战指南(新手友好版) 你是不是也有这样的经历?家里的小米盒子卡成PPT,开机先看30秒广告;华为悦盒系统更新停在三年前,连最新版爱奇艺都装不上&#xff…

作者头像 李华
网站建设 2026/3/28 5:55:27

OpenSpec兼容性测试:YOLOv8在不同硬件平台的表现

OpenSpec兼容性测试:YOLOv8在不同硬件平台的表现 在智能安防摄像头需要实时识别行人、工业质检设备要精准定位缺陷、自动驾驶系统必须毫秒级响应障碍物的今天,目标检测早已不再是实验室里的概念验证。它已深度嵌入现实世界的边缘计算场景中——而这些场…

作者头像 李华
网站建设 2026/3/31 6:45:42

智能体技术实战指南:10个创新应用场景的深度解析与实现方案

智能体技术正在彻底改变我们处理复杂任务的方式。通过多智能体协作架构,我们可以构建从学术研究到日常生活的全方位智能助手系统。本文将通过10个精心设计的实战案例,为您展示如何从零开始构建功能强大的智能体应用,涵盖科研创新、数据分析、…

作者头像 李华
网站建设 2026/3/19 11:33:23

Google Gemini API实战指南:从入门到精通

Google Gemini API实战指南:从入门到精通 【免费下载链接】Gemini-API ✨ An elegant async Python wrapper for Google Gemini web app 项目地址: https://gitcode.com/gh_mirrors/gem/Gemini-API 在人工智能快速发展的今天,Google Gemini作为业…

作者头像 李华